Sandra Caponi is a scholar working on Clinical Psychology, General Health Professions and Demography. According to data from OpenAlex, Sandra Caponi has authored 89 papers receiving a total of 662 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 42 papers in Clinical Psychology, 28 papers in General Health Professions and 16 papers in Demography. Recurrent topics in Sandra Caponi’s work include Psychology and Mental Health (34 papers), Health, Nursing, Elderly Care (24 papers) and Youth, Drugs, and Violence (16 papers). Sandra Caponi is often cited by papers focused on Psychology and Mental Health (34 papers), Health, Nursing, Elderly Care (24 papers) and Youth, Drugs, and Violence (16 papers). Sandra Caponi collaborates with scholars based in Brazil, Spain and Argentina. Sandra Caponi's co-authors include Marta Inêz Machado Verdi, Águeda Lenita Pereira Wendhausen, Elza Berger Salema Coelho, Paulo Poli Neto, Fernanda Rebelo, Ángel Martínez Hernáez, Guillermo Folguera and Carlos Botazzo and has published in prestigious journals such as Cadernos de Saúde Pública, Archives of Medical Research and Ciência & Saúde Coletiva.
